Csv To JSON
इनपुट सीएसवी
0 वर्ण
आउटपुट JSON
प्रारूप:
JSON आउटपुट यहां दिखाई देगा…
नकल की गई!
डेवलपर उपकरण

CSV से JSON कन्वर्टर

अल्पविराम से अलग किए गए डेटा को तुरंत अपने ब्राउज़र के अंदर संरचित JSON प्रारूप में परिवर्तित करें। सुरक्षित, त्वरित और ऑफ़लाइन-सक्षम।

ऑनलाइन CSV से JSON कन्वर्टर के साथ टेबल डेटा को रूपांतरित करें

कॉमा-सेपरेटेड वैल्यूज़ (सीएसवी) का व्यापक रूप से प्रशासन, स्प्रेडशीट प्रसंस्करण और बुनियादी फ़ाइल भंडारण में उपयोग किया जाता है क्योंकि वे हल्के और सार्वभौमिक होते हैं। हालाँकि, आधुनिक वेब सिस्टम, REST API और MongoDB जैसे NoSQL डेटाबेस डेटा रिकॉर्ड को क्वेरी करने, लोड करने और संचारित करने के लिए संरचित जावास्क्रिप्ट ऑब्जेक्ट नोटेशन (JSON) पेलोड पर बहुत अधिक निर्भर करते हैं।

हमारा इंटरैक्टिव csv to json कनवर्टर सारणीबद्ध और संरचित डेटा संरचनाओं के बीच अंतर को पाटता है। अपनी कच्ची स्प्रैडशीट, डेटाबेस तालिकाओं या लॉगिंग आउटपुट को कॉपी-पेस्ट करके, आप उन्हें तुरंत मानक JSON प्रारूप में बदल सकते हैं। यह सीमांकक परिवर्तनों को संभालता है, नेस्टेड डेटा प्रतिनिधित्व का समर्थन करता है, और स्वचालित रूप से कॉलम को संबंधित विशेषताओं में मैप करता है।

CSV से JSON रूपांतरण प्रक्रिया को समझना

सीएसवी डेटा एक्सचेंज की भाषा है। माइक्रोसॉफ्ट एक्सेल से लेकर गूगल शीट्स तक हर स्प्रेडशीट एप्लिकेशन और लगभग हर डेटाबेस प्रबंधन प्रणाली सीएसवी में टेबल निर्यात करने का समर्थन करती है। हालाँकि, CSV मूलतः सपाट, पाठ-आधारित है और इसमें संरचनात्मक टाइपिंग का अभाव है। दूसरी ओर, JSON आधुनिक वेब विकास, API, NoSQL डेटाबेस और एप्लिकेशन कॉन्फ़िगरेशन के लिए मानक प्रारूप है।

CSV को JSON में परिवर्तित करने में पंक्तियों और स्तंभों के दो-आयामी ग्रिड को पार्स करना और उन्हें संरचित वस्तुओं की एक सरणी में मैप करना शामिल है। यदि CSV फ़ाइल में हेडर पंक्ति है, तो प्रत्येक कॉलम नाम एक कुंजी बन जाता है, और प्रत्येक पंक्ति का सेल मान संबंधित मान बन जाता है। डेटा प्रारूपों को सही ढंग से परिवर्तित करने के लिए सीमांकक को संबोधित करने, हेडर नामों की जांच करने और आउटपुट कॉन्फ़िगरेशन निर्धारित करने की आवश्यकता होती है।

संपूर्ण डेटा गोपनीयता के लिए पूर्ण क्लाइंट-साइड निष्पादन

मालिकाना ग्राहक डेटाबेस, ईमेल पते, मूल्य निर्धारण सूची, या व्यावसायिक वित्तीय विवरण संसाधित करते समय गोपनीयता सर्वोपरि है। अन्य ऑनलाइन कन्वर्टर्स के विपरीत, जो आपके डेटा को दूरस्थ वेब सर्वर पर अपलोड करते हैं, कहें.टूल्स 100% निजी मॉडल पर काम करता है।

सभी पार्सिंग, कैरेक्टर टोकनाइजेशन और स्कीमा समायोजन सीधे आपके स्थानीय ब्राउज़र के सैंडबॉक्स के अंदर होते हैं। कोई नेटवर्क क्वेरी नहीं की जाती है, और आपकी फ़ाइलें कभी भी रिकॉर्ड, निरीक्षण या बाहरी डेटाबेस में नहीं भेजी जाती हैं। आप निजी व्यावसायिक दस्तावेज़ों को पूरी तरह से ऑफ़लाइन रूपांतरित कर सकते हैं। यह ब्राउज़र-आधारित सैंडबॉक्स डिज़ाइन आपकी कंपनी के डेटा को सुरक्षा लीक और सर्वर-साइड स्टोरेज जोखिमों से सुरक्षित रखता है।

इंटेलिजेंट डिलीमीटर ऑटो-डिटेक्शन और नेस्टिंग विकल्प

सभी सारणीबद्ध फ़ाइलें विभाजक मान के रूप में अल्पविराम का उपयोग नहीं करती हैं। कई सिस्टम अर्धविराम, टैब (टीएसवी), या पाइप (|) का उपयोग करके डेटासेट निर्यात करते हैं। हमारे टूल में एक अंतर्निहित ऑटो-डिटेक्ट सिस्टम है जो सक्रिय विभाजक को तुरंत निर्धारित करने के लिए आपके इनपुट टेक्स्ट के स्कीमा हेडर का विश्लेषण करता है।

इसके अलावा, हम उन्नत डॉट-नोटेशन हेडर का समर्थन करते हैं। यदि आपके CSV में user.profile.name या user.profile.role जैसे शीर्षक हैं, तो नेस्टिंग टॉगल को सक्षम करने से हमारे इंजन को एक संरचित चाइल्ड पदानुक्रम को स्वचालित रूप से पुनर्निर्माण करने का निर्देश मिलता है। एक सपाट वस्तु के बजाय, कनवर्टर साफ, नेस्टेड उप-ऑब्जेक्ट को आउटपुट करता है, जैसे { "उपयोगकर्ता": { "प्रोफ़ाइल": { "नाम": "मान" } } }.

लचीले लेआउट: JSON एरेज़ बनाम कुंजीयुक्त ऑब्जेक्ट

आपके अंतिम लक्ष्य के आधार पर, आपको भिन्न JSON लेआउट की आवश्यकता हो सकती है। एक मानक json array प्रत्येक पंक्ति को एक सूची ऑब्जेक्ट पर मैप करता है, जो एपीआई पेलोड के लिए आदर्श है। वैकल्पिक रूप से, पहले कॉलम (जैसे आईडी) को शब्दकोश कुंजी में बदलने के लिए हमारे कीड ऑब्जेक्ट कॉन्फ़िगरेशन को चुनें, प्रत्येक रिकॉर्ड को एक इंडेक्सेबल डेटा हैश तालिका में मैप करें।

सामान्य सीएसवी एज मामलों को संबोधित करना

गैर-मानक स्वरूपण के कारण CSV पार्सिंग में सिंटैक्स विफलताओं का खतरा होता है। यहां बताया गया है कि हमारा कनवर्टर सामान्य किनारे के मामलों को कैसे संभालता है:

  • एस्केप्ड डबल कोट्स: आरएफसी 4180 के अनुसार, डिलीमीटर, डबल कोट्स या न्यूलाइन वाले फ़ील्ड को डबल कोट्स में संलग्न किया जाना चाहिए। यदि किसी उद्धृत फ़ील्ड के अंदर एक दोहरा उद्धरण दिखाई देता है, तो उसे उसके पहले एक और दोहरा उद्धरण (उदाहरण के लिए, <कोड>"द ""क्विक"" ब्राउन फॉक्स") लगाकर बचना चाहिए। हमारा पार्सर इस मानक का सम्मान करता है और एस्केप्ड कोट्स का सही ढंग से समाधान करता है।
  • मल्टीलाइन मान: कभी-कभी एकल CSV सेल में लाइन ब्रेक होते हैं। एक बुनियादी पंक्ति-दर-पंक्ति विभाजन ऐसी फ़ाइलों की पार्सिंग को तोड़ देगा। हमारा स्टेटफुल पार्सर एक ही कुंजी के तहत मल्टीलाइन मानों को उचित रूप से समूहित करने के लिए खुले और बंद उद्धरण संदर्भों का ट्रैक रखते हुए, चरित्र-दर-चरित्र पढ़ता है।
  • बेमेल कॉलम गणना: यदि किसी पंक्ति में हेडर पंक्ति की तुलना में कम कॉलम हैं, तो पार्सर स्वचालित रूप से लापता कुंजियों को खाली स्ट्रिंग्स से भर देता है। यदि किसी पंक्ति में अतिरिक्त कॉलम हैं, तो उन्हें चयनित विकल्पों के आधार पर सुंदर ढंग से छोटा कर दिया जाता है या गतिशील रूप से संग्रहीत किया जाता है।
  • डेटा प्रकार ज़बरदस्ती: CSV मान अलिखित पाठ हैं। JSON में, संख्याओं, बूलियन और नल के अलग-अलग प्रकार होते हैं। डेवलपर्स आसानी से आउटपुट को छोटा या सुंदर-मुद्रित JSON के रूप में प्रारूपित कर सकते हैं, जिससे उन्हें क्लीनर कच्चे पेलोड को सीधे अपने लक्ष्य कोडबेस में कॉपी करने की अनुमति मिलती है।

अक्सर पूछे जाने वाले प्रश्न

मैं CSV को JSON में ऑनलाइन कैसे परिवर्तित करूं?

बस अपना CSV डेटा इनपुट फ़ील्ड में पेस्ट करें या \ क्लिक करें

क्या मेरी व्यावसायिक CSV फ़ाइलों को ऑनलाइन परिवर्तित करना सुरक्षित है?

हाँ, हमारा CSV से JSON कनवर्टर 100% सुरक्षित है। क्योंकि टूल आपके वेब ब्राउज़र में जावास्क्रिप्ट का उपयोग करके पूरी तरह से क्लाइंट-साइड चलता है, इसलिए कोई भी डेटा हमारे सर्वर पर नहीं भेजा जाता है, नेटवर्क पर अपलोड नहीं किया जाता है, या कहीं भी संग्रहीत नहीं किया जाता है। आपके संवेदनशील व्यावसायिक रिकॉर्ड और मालिकाना स्प्रैडशीट आपके स्थानीय डिवाइस पर पूरी तरह से निजी और सुरक्षित रहते हैं।

क्या यह टैब, अर्धविराम या कस्टम डिलीमीटर का समर्थन करता है?

हाँ, हमारा कनवर्टर सीमांकक के स्वतः-पहचान के साथ-साथ मैन्युअल चयन का भी समर्थन करता है। आप PostgreSQL, MySQL, या Microsoft Excel जैसे डेटाबेस से निर्यात किए गए विभिन्न CSV प्रारूपों को समायोजित करने के लिए टूलबार मेनू से TSV फ़ाइलों के लिए अल्पविराम (,), अर्धविराम (;), टैब (\\t), या पाइप (|) निर्दिष्ट कर सकते हैं।

डॉट-नोटेशन नेस्टिंग रिज़ॉल्यूशन कैसे काम करता है?

जब\

JSON ऐरे और कीड ऑब्जेक्ट प्रारूपों के बीच क्या अंतर है?

JSON ऐरे प्रारूप ऑब्जेक्ट्स की एक मानक सरणी तैयार करता है जहां प्रत्येक पंक्ति सरणी में एक आइटम का प्रतिनिधित्व करती है। कीड ऑब्जेक्ट प्रारूप प्रत्येक पंक्ति के पहले कॉलम में मान (उदाहरण के लिए, एक आईडी या उपयोगकर्ता नाम) को मूल ऑब्जेक्ट में एक अद्वितीय कुंजी के रूप में उपयोग करता है, शेष कॉलम डेटा को उस कुंजी के तहत नेस्टेड गुणों के रूप में मैप करता है। यह आपके एप्लिकेशन की डेटा पार्सिंग आवश्यकताओं के लिए सही संरचना चुनने में आपकी सहायता करता है।

मुख्य